Healthcare Litigator Maddigan Joins Hogan Lovells

 

By a MetNews Staff Writer

 

Michael Maddigan, a former partner with the Los Angeles office of O’Melveny & Myers, has joined Hogan Lovells.

The firm announced yesterday that Maddigan has been added to the firm as a litigation partner, explaining that his arrival furthers the firm’s recent strategy of continuing to expand its litigation practice.

“Mike’s arrival reinforces our global Healthcare practice and Life Sciences industry group,” the firm’s press release quoted Barry Dastin, who is Hogan Lovells’ managing partner in the Los Angeles office, as saying. “His healthcare litigation practice matches perfectly with Hogan Lovells’ deep healthcare regulatory expertise.”

Maddigan served as co-chair of O’Melveny & Myers’ health care and life sciences practice. He was the president of the Association of Business Trial Lawyers.

He co-authored “Health Care Reform: Law and Practice,” a treatise dealing with the Affordable Care Act’s impact on employee benefit plans, employers, insurance providers, and state health insurance exchanges.

Maddigan serves on the boards of directors for the City Law Center and Los Angeles Legal Aid Foundation. Maddigan graduated cum laude from the Georgetown University School of Foreign Service, and received his law degree from UC Berkeley, where he was an articles editor of the Law Review.
